The story takes place about eight days after the Confession of Peter (9:18-20), Jesus first passion prediction (9:21-22), and his admonitions about following him (9:23-27). For Moses died 1400 years earlier, and Elijah was taken into heaven 800 years earlier, and here they are now in front of Peter, James, and John alive and in glory. All three of the Synoptics place the Transfiguration immediately after Jesus first passion pronouncement, emphasizing that the one who willbe killed, and on the third day be raised up (v. 22) is not a random victim of violence, but is the Son of God carrying out Gods plan (v. 35). None of the Gospels tells us why he wants to build three tents: Perhaps he wants to prolong the mountaintop experienceto keep Jesus safe on the mountain rather than seeing him exposed to suffering, rejection, and death (v. 22). The cloud was the symbol of the presence of God at Sinai (Exodus 24:15-16; 34:5), and it symbolizes Gods presence for these three disciples. Action is both his strength and his weakness.
